Optimization of photometric determination of U with arsenazo III for direct determination of U in steels, soils and waters

Description
Conditions were optimized for the reaction of U(VI) with arsenazo III. Recommended as the optimal medium for photometric determination of uranium in the concentration range 0.5 to 50 μg U/ml was the glycine buffer with pH 1.2 to 2.2. The results of the suggested method have better reproducibility than those of the mineral acid procedure used so far. Complexone III should be added to mask the other cations accompanying uranium in steels, waters and rocks. (author)
